In advance of next week's B1G media days the Big Ten released its preseason poll, and the news was predictably not very good. Coming off of a dismal 1-11 season the Boilers are picked to finish dead last in the west division and received the lowest votes overall:

Big Ten East

  1. Ohio State, 195 points (23 first-place votes)
  2. Michigan State, 180 points (10)
  3. Michigan, 136 points
  4. Penn State, 105.5 points
  5. Maryland, 84 points
  6. Indiana, 78.5 points
  7. Rutgers, 33 points

Big Ten West

  1. Wisconsin, 183.5 points (15)
  2. Iowa, 173 points (11)
  3. Nebraska, 157.7 points (5)
  4. Northwestern, 112 points (1)
  5. Minnesota, 96.5 points
  6. Illinois, 58 points
  7. Purdue, 31.5 points

Picks to win Big Ten Championship

Ohio State 19, Michigan State 9, Nebraska 1

Yes, Rutgers, who is new to the Big Ten, is held in higher esteem. As is Illinois, who has one a single Big Ten game in the last 2.5 years and Indiana, the worst major conference team of all time.
